Based on Q1 2026 13F filings, institutional ownership of Dave Inc. stands at 49.4%, held across 265 reporting institutions.
Hood River Capital Management LLC is the largest reported institutional holder of DAVE, with approximately 1,145,901 shares worth $0.20B as of Q1 2026.
Yes β 3 widely-followed marquee investors appear among the top 25 institutional holders of DAVE, including SUSQUEHANNA INTERNATIONAL GROUP, LLP, RENAISSANCE TECHNOLOGIES LLC, CITADEL ADVISORS LLC.
Our composite Smart Money Score for DAVE is 45 out of 100 (Neutral). It combines net institutional buying activity, ownership shift, marquee investor presence, and holder-count growth.
60 institutions opened new positions in DAVE during Q1 2026, while 79 fully exited. 56 added to existing positions and 148 trimmed.
DAVE institutional ownership fell by 13.68 percentage points quarter-over-quarter, with a net change of -19 holders.
The top 10 institutions account for 49.3% of all reported 13F value in DAVE, and the top 25 account for 73.2%.
All data is sourced from SEC Form 13F filings, which institutional investment managers with at least $100M in assets are required to file each quarter. We process every 13F filing from EDGAR and recompute the aggregates after each cycle. Insider transactions are sourced from Form 4 filings.
